What does a little philosophy unclineth man's mind to atheism mean?

I think the quotation is actually "A little philosophy inclineth man's mind to atheism", said by Francis Bacon. Bacon was a 16th century English philosopher.The full quotation is "A little philosophy inclineth man's mind to atheism, but depth in philosophy bringeth men's minds about to religion."What Bacon meant was that if someone thinks briefly about God, he will think that there is no God, if he thinks deeply about God he will start to believe. Although nowadays, most philosophers probably are atheists the priniciple of thinking deeply about things before coming to a conclusion still stands.
